they will fit but look awkward. they are not staggered fitment and the offsets are a little high, even if they were for fronts only. 19x8 +30 would be a lot more flush but they are +50 for the front. having 19x8 +50 for rear would take away from the classy look of BBS LM's.

my verdict: do not buy

I dont know how the width of the rim effects the clearance, but having 8.5" wide front with +38 offset (18inch), I barely have 1/4" clearance ,if that, between front face of the caliper and the rim. Radial clearance would not be a problem. You may need spacers. Good luck!

Here is my set up: 18inch, 8.5f x 9.5r, both being +38 offset.
